Palladium(II) Halide Complexes I. Stabilities and Spectra of Palladium(II) Chloro and Bromo Aqua Complexes

Elding, Lars Ivar LU (1972) In Inorganica Chimica Acta 6. p.647-651
Abstract
Stability constants, βn, n = 1, 2, 3, 4, for the chloro and bromo complexes of palladium(II) have been calculated, using a least squares programme, from spectrophotometric measurements at 222, 234.5 and 279 nm (chloride) and at 247, 265, and 332 nm (bromide). The following values of lg(βn/M−n) were obtained: 4.47±0.01, 7.76±0.04, 10.17±0.07, and 11.54±0.09 (chloride) and 5.17±0.02, 9.42±0.04, 12.72±0.06, and 14.94±0.08 (bromide). Spectra of the species PdXn(H2O)4−n2−n, n = 0, 1, 2, 3, 4; X = Cl, Br, have been determined in the wave length region 210 to 600 nm. The temperature was 25.0°C and the ionic medium 1.00 M perchloric acid.
